Those old cameras are still amazing. When things went digital, some aspects of cameras actually became worse. For instance, those old cameras almost always had a pentaprism instead of a pentamirror. The pentaprism is an actual crystal that flips and reverses the image, and the pentamirror is just mirrors arranged to do the same thing, but compared to a prism the mirrors are way more dim. The prism is what gives cameras the usual triangular hump in front of the viewfinder.

And until recently it was nearly impossible to find a digital camera without an anti-aliasing filter. The filter is basically a piece of glass to eliminate moire in images, caused by the arrangement of pixels on the sensor. The glass eliminates/lessens moire, but you lose a bit of sharpness in the end. Film is organic and random, so there was no need for any sort of filter. Nikon has a few cameras without the filter, so you still get moire in rare cases, and Fuji has an alternative pixel layout for their sensors that eliminates moire.

Canon also had a really interesting autofocus system on their later 35mm SLRs. Instead of cycling through the focus points or hoping the camera guesses what you want to focus on (as you have to do with cameras now), the AF system would look at where your eye was looking in the viewfinder and focus accordingly. I never used it but I've heard mixed things about it. Some people said it didn't work with glasses, some said it worked amazingly well. Canon dropped it from their DSLRs because of battery power issues.

Speaking of batteries, older SLRs either don't need batteries, or have batteries that last for months or years. For some cameras the battery was only needed for the metering system, so you could still use the camera if the battery died. Some cameras that used electronic shutters had one 'emergency' shutter speed that was entirely mechanical for use if the battery died. Neat stuff.

Also, the lenses. Good god, older lenses are a pleasure to use. The focus rings are so smooth and the aperture rings are so nice and clicky. They had more accurate distance scales too, and had depth of field scales as well.

Going back to viewfinders, the older ones were bigger and brighter as well. The mirror in modern cameras is often a bit transparent because the AF sensor is usually behind/below the mirror. When older cameras had no AF the mirrors could be actual mirrors, so the image shown in the viewfinder was nice and bright, especially with a bright/fast/large aperture lens. The image size of the viewfinder was often bigger too, to help with manually focusing and they often had manual focusing aids. With an older camera if you put a slower lens on the camera, looked through the viewfinder, and then put on a faster lens and looked through the viewfinder again, the image would actually be brighter for the brighter lens and depth of field would be more accurately displayed for the two lenses in the viewfinder. Nowadays focusing screens actually aren't very bright and are fixed to show around f/4, even with a faster lens. That means if you put any lens faster than f/4 on the camera, you won't notice a difference in the viewfinder. The image won't be brighter, and the depth of field won't be accurately shown in the viewfinder. However, if you put a lens slower than f/4 on there, you'll notice it get darker. Why this change was made, I have no idea. Manufacturers did start coming out with slower lenses around the same time, so maybe they figured nobody would notice or something. I don't know, I'm not an engineer. There's a nice market for aftermarket focusing screens so some people from eBay go out and buy older cameras, cut the focusing screens to fit in modern DSLRs, and sell them.

Less. I picked up a canon FTb + 50/1.8 for $25, got a 35/2.5 in that mount for free, a 70-210/4.5-5.6 for free, Canon AT-1 + 50/1.8 and Motor Drive for $35, ect.

You can pick up cameras and lenses cheap if you hit up flea markets and yard sales, you just have to make sure everything works and is clean before you buy anything.

Old Canons use a different mount than the newer Canons, so the old FD mount is basically a dead system and usually pretty cheap. It's really once you get outside the range of normal lenses(50/1.8, 35/2.8, 70-200/4-5.6) that everyone would have had that the price starts to kick up. Ultrawides and fisheyes still demand $500+, as do ultra fast lenses like the 50/1.2.
